Revelation 7 Study Bible
Revelation 7 begins with the imagery of four angels holding back the winds of the earth, symbolizing divine restraint and protection. This theme highlights God's control over the elements and His intention to protect His creation from impending judgment.

INTRODUCTION TO REVELATION 7. This chapter contains a vision seen at the end of the sixth, and at the opening of the seventh seal, which expresses the security of the saints in all ages following, the praises of angels and men on that account, and the happiness of all the people of God in the millennium state.
